Abba Self Storage in Concord, CA, Completes Expansion

Abba Self Storage has completed a 20,000-square-foot expansion to its facility in Concord, Calif. The company added mostly larger units up to 15 by 35 feet to keep up with market demand and rental trends, according to the source. Jeff Smith, property manager, said customers are migrating toward the larger units.

The cost isnt really that much more for the bigger units, and it definitely makes it easier when storing household furniture, a car or boat, he said, adding that the larger units also have taller and wider doors for easier access. All our units are individually equipped with alarms and sprinkler systems as well as 24-hour monitoring.

Located near Highway 4 and Highway 242, the facility serves Californias East Bay, including the communities of Concord, Martinez, Pacheco, Pittsburg, Pleasant Hill and Walnut Creek. The facility includes boat/RV and records storage.

Storage facilities have even gone after greater curb appeal and are no longer the neglected-looking buildings found in out of the way locations, company officials said in a press release. Many of the newer facilities are built with architectural details and designs that use to be reserved for high-end office space or apartment buildings.
